Jeff Nygaard, the head men’s volleyball coach at the University of Southern California, is joining the AVCA Board of Directors.
He becomes the NCAA Division I-II Men’s Representative after being appointed to replace Donan Cruz. Nygaard will serve on the Board through Dec. 31, 2027.
The 2025 season marked Nygaard’s 10th at the helm of the USC men’s program, and he led the Trojans to a 21-7 record. That marks an eight-win improvement over last year, and his 2025 squad had 14 wins against ranked teams.
Before taking over as the USC head coach a decade ago, Nygaard served five years as a Trojan assistant from 2011–15. He had a storied playing career, which included being a three-time Olympian—US men’s indoor team member in 1996 and 2000 and beach Olympian in 2004—and playing on two college national championship teams at UCLA.
Effective immediately, Nygaard joins the other 16 members of the AVCA Board, which includes a blend of elected representatives and appointed members.
